I was looking to get a wireless alarm system earlier in the year and came across that blog post while doing some research.
I went for the Yale system instead because it does not use the same dip switches that make the Response alarms so easy to crack.
I have no detailed technical knowledge but I could figure out how to exploit the vulnerability in the Response alarm in about 20 minutes.0 -
